Regular lock and lock off of MacArthur Blvd (where you should park). These woods were known as Jarvis Hills back in the day. The following is an excerpt from Haddon Township Historical Society: '"The Jarvis Place" sat on the hill now occupied by the Superfresh supermarket. The property, which in 1864 included 114 acres of farmland, woods, orchards, streams and buildings, encompassed what is presently the grounds of the Haddon Township High School and Middle School, the Haddon Twp. branch of the Camden County Library, the Haddon View Apartments, the Westmont Shopping Plaza, the woods along MacArthur Boulevard up to Saddlertown, the Paul VI High School property, and the Van Sciver Elementary School grounds.
The house was destroyed by fire on October 11, 1967, which also took the life of Westmont Firefighter Daniel DiPaolo.'
As a kid growing up in the 1960's, I would spend hours playing on the hills.
